38 But if you say, ‘the burden of the Lord’, thus says the Lord: Because you have said these words, ‘the burden of the Lord’, when I sent to you, saying, You shall not say, ‘the burden of the Lord’, 39 therefore, I will surely lift you up[a] and cast you away from my presence, you and the city that I gave to you and your ancestors. 40 And I will bring upon you everlasting disgrace and perpetual shame, which shall not be forgotten.

38 Although you claim, ‘This is a message from the Lord,’ this is what the Lord says: You used the words, ‘This is a message from the Lord,’ even though I told you that you must not claim, ‘This is a message from the Lord.’ 39 Therefore, I will surely forget you and cast(A) you out of my presence along with the city I gave to you and your ancestors. 40 I will bring on you everlasting disgrace(B)—everlasting shame that will not be forgotten.”
